Comprehensive Service Overview

Garage door repair in Ukiah typically covers the same core issues you’d find anywhere, but with a few local twists. Because many homes here are older or more rustic, the equipment can range from decades-old manual doors to modern insulated models with smart openers. Understanding what’s actually going on with your door is the first step toward getting it sorted.

Spring and cable work is one of the most common repairs. The high-tension springs that lift your door endure a lot of stress, especially through freeze-thaw cycles. When they snap, the door becomes heavy and unsafe to operate. Replacing these requires careful handling—this is not a DIY job for good reason.

Opener troubleshooting is another frequent need. Whether it’s a LiftMaster, Chamberlain, or Genie unit, issues with remotes, keypads, or wall switches often come down to sensor alignment, power surges, or worn internal components. A thorough diagnosis can save you from replacing an opener that just needs a simple fix.

Track and roller adjustments help when a door is off-track, grinding, or sticking. In a rural setting, gravel driveways and seasonal mud can throw things out of alignment faster than in paved urban areas. Getting everything back in proper position prevents further wear and noisy operation.

Every repair visit in this area typically includes a multi-point safety and balance check of rollers, cables, sensors, and tracks. This gives you a clear picture of your door’s condition and what might need attention down the road—no surprises, just straightforward information to work with.

Regional Characteristics

Ukiah sits in a mountain valley in Umatilla County, surrounded by the Umatilla National Forest. It’s a deeply rural area where homes range from older cabins and farmsteads to more recent owner-built residences. The climate brings cold, snowy winters and dry summers, which takes a toll on moving parts left exposed to the elements. Properties are often set back from the road, with longer driveways and garage setups that differ from typical suburban layouts.

Common Issues

Garage doors in this region commonly show wear from temperature swings—frozen tracks in winter, warped seals, and openers that struggle in the cold. Spring breakage and snapped cables are frequent concerns, especially on older doors that haven’t been serviced in a while. Rural properties also contend with more dust and debris, which can affect sensor alignment and track function over time.
